What is Technology and Automation?
Technology refers to the application of scientific knowledge for practical purposes, especially in industry. Automation, on the other hand, refers to the use of technology to control and operate machines and processes without human intervention. Automation involves the use of computers, robots, and other machines to perform tasks that were previously done by humans.
Automation can be categorized into different types, including fixed automation, programmable automation, and flexible automation. Fixed automation involves the use of machines that are designed to perform a specific task and cannot be changed. Programmable automation involves the use of machines that can be programmed to perform different tasks. Flexible automation involves the use of machines that can be programmed to perform a variety of tasks and can be easily changed.
Benefits of Technology and Automation
The benefits of technology and automation are numerous. Some of the most significant benefits include increased efficiency, improved accuracy, and reduced costs. Automation can perform tasks with greater speed and accuracy than humans, which can lead to increased productivity and efficiency. Additionally, automation can reduce the risk of human error, which can lead to improved quality and reliability.
Automation can also improve safety in the workplace. By automating tasks that are hazardous or dangerous, automation can reduce the risk of injury or death. Furthermore, automation can provide real-time monitoring and feedback, which can help to identify and correct problems quickly.
Impact of Technology and Automation on Industries
Technology and automation have had a significant impact on various industries, including manufacturing, healthcare, finance, and transportation. In manufacturing, automation has enabled the production of high-quality products with greater speed and efficiency. In healthcare, automation has enabled the development of new medical devices and treatments, as well as improved patient care.
In finance, automation has enabled the development of online banking and mobile payment systems, which have made it easier for people to manage their finances. In transportation, automation has enabled the development of self-driving cars and drones, which have the potential to revolutionize the way we travel.
Examples of Technology and Automation in Action
There are many examples of technology and automation in action. One example is the use of robots in manufacturing. Robots can be programmed to perform tasks such as welding, assembly, and inspection, which can improve efficiency and accuracy.
Another example is the use of artificial intelligence in healthcare. Artificial intelligence can be used to analyze medical images, diagnose diseases, and develop personalized treatment plans. Additionally, artificial intelligence can be used to develop chatbots and virtual assistants, which can provide patients with personalized support and guidance.
Challenges and Limitations of Technology and Automation
While technology and automation have many benefits, there are also challenges and limitations. One of the biggest challenges is the potential for job displacement. As automation replaces human workers, there is a risk that many people will lose their jobs.
Another challenge is the need for skilled workers to maintain and repair automated systems. As automation becomes more complex, there is a need for workers with specialized skills to maintain and repair these systems.
Future of Technology and Automation
The future of technology and automation is exciting and rapidly evolving. One of the most significant trends is the development of artificial intelligence and machine learning. These technologies have the potential to enable automation to learn and adapt to new situations, which can improve efficiency and accuracy.
Another trend is the development of the Internet of Things (IoT). The IoT refers to the network of physical devices, vehicles, and other items that are embedded with sensors, software, and connectivity, allowing them to collect and exchange data. The IoT has the potential to enable automation to be integrated into everyday life, from smart homes to smart cities.
